#c0fe58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0fe58 is composed of 75.3% red, 99.6%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 82.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#c0fe58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#81f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#c0fe58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0fe58 has RGB values of R:192, G:254,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0. Its decimal value is 12648024.

Shades and Tints of #c0fe58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050800 is the darkest color, while #fbfff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0fe58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b0a6 is the less saturated color, while #c0fe58 is the most saturated one.
